Just by chance on the next evening I came across a meadow in Munich's world famous English Garden when I heard sounds not too familiar in this area: a pipe band took advantage of the fine weather and rehearsed outside their regular band room. A truly nice sound but with unaided ears it was impossible for me to step closer so I could shoot my panorama standing inside their circle.
People coming from the beergarden just around the corner and other visitors of the park just stood there in a safe distance and were amazed by the tunes.

- Voigtländer Bessa-L with Ultra-Heliar 12 mm wide angle lens, Novoflex head and mini tripod
- Fuji Reala 35 mm negative film exposed 1/4 th sec. at f 8.5
- Full 16 bit workflow: scanned with Nikon LS-4000 / Silverfast, stitched with huginOSX 0.6.1, edited with Photoshop 8 (CS)
